Looking for information on TOTIRE, originating in the Bari area.
I heard it was a variant of TOTARO. Was this name possibly based on "Saint Theodore of Tyre"? I understand this was a popular saint among certain populations of that region.

Totaro surname, tipicallysurname of Bari and Brindisi area, has origin from diminutive italian first name Teodoro, coming from greek name Theodorus ( from language contraction contractio totorus)
formed from greek words: theòs = God, and dóron = gift, therefore means "gift of God"; really Saint Theodore of Tyre has popular devotion in Brindisi town (near Bari town)..
Totire is an version, misspelled in the past, of original Totaro surname..
